11213201132167 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 11213201132168. Its totient is φ = 11213201132166.

The previous prime is 11213201132129. The next prime is 11213201132201. The reversal of 11213201132167 is 76123110231211.

It is a strong prime.

It is a cyclic number.

It is not a de Polignac number, because 11213201132167 - 243 = 2417108109959 is a prime.

It is a congruent number.

It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(11213201136167) by changing a digit.

It is a pernicious number, because its binary representation contains a prime number (23) of ones.

It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 5606600566083 + 5606600566084.

It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(5606600566084).

Almost surely, 211213201132167 is an apocalyptic number.

11213201132167 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1).

11213201132167 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.

11213201132167 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.

The product of its (nonzero) digits is 3024, while the sum is 31.

Adding to 11213201132167 its reverse (76123110231211), we get a palindrome (87336311363378).

The spelling of 11213201132167 in words is "eleven trillion, two hundred thirteen billion, two hundred one million, one hundred thirty-two thousand, one hundred sixty-seven".
